Vegan Parmesan Truffle Tater Tots

Homemade tater tots flavored with vegan Parmesan and truffle oil, served with garlic aioli.

Instructions

  • If using the homemade vegan Parmesan, make it first, by adding the cashews, nutritional yeast and salt to a food processor and pulsing until it is a fine crumble like real Parmesan. Set aside.
  • In a large pot, fill with water and then add the peeled potatoes. Bring to a simmer, and cook for 6-8 minutes, just until a little softer, you don't want them to be cooked all the way through.
  • Drain and cool for a few minutes so you can handle them. Grate the potatoes, and then add them to a mixing bowl with the flour, salt and pepper, nutritional yeast, and 2 tsp. of truffle oil. Mix together. 
  • Heat a few tablespoons of oil in a non stick skillet. Form the potato mixture into tots using your hands. Just press together and make it as tot like as you can. Fry the tots in batches for a minute or two on each side until nice and brown.
  • You can make sure they are cooked all the way through in the pan, or finish them in the oven. If you want to do that, place the fried ones on a baking sheet and bake for about 10 more minutes on 375 degrees.
  • While you are cooking the tots, make the aioli by mixing all the ingredients together. Set aside. They are also super delicious with just ketchup!
  • Once the tots are completely done, toss with the remaining 2 tsp. of truffle oil and the vegan Parmesan. Serve immediately,
